The copy cat recipe for IHOP'S Harvest Grain Pancakes calls for powdered malt or something like that which I finally found where they carry beer making supplies. However, as I was trying to find this, it was suggested that I call Brueggers Bagel Bakery. They use the liquid or the malt extract. I feel like the local pub that makes their own beer also used the liquid but I could be wrong. I think that maybe if you try a bakery where the people are nice that they might sell you some. Brueggers would have sold me some of their extract but that isn't what I was looking for. I hope that this suggestion helps you locate it. Good luck:-)
